mysql desc用法_MySQL学习笔记

这周真的没学习什么东西,就把MySQL的基本语句学了一下,现在写这个笔记做一下总结。

数据库是按照数据结构来组织,储存和管理数据的仓库,结构化查询语言(Structured Query Language)简称SQL,是上世纪70年代由IBM公司开发用于对数据库进行操作的语言。

MySQL是一个BDMS(数据库管理系统),MySQL使用SQL语言进行操作。

1 . 新建数据库

语句:CREATE DATABASE mysql_shiyan

创建成功之后使用语句showdatabases;就能看到新建的数据库了。如下图。

7ed57c6303add8f9d41b37bd909b3c3a.png

2. use mysql_shiyan 连接数据库 之后就可以对这个数据进行一些操作了,比如插入删除

3.新建一个表:

b8a6a3505e3cf2c55297fed314a78515.png

比如:

877541680ba0478baacb3488fbaf0cd2.png

就新建了一个empolyee的表。

4.插入语句:

98642a02cdc6dca88ff4c2d0b9e1283f.png

之后使用语句:

d92393065a0a5685b22d808fffc59c49.png

490624697bf54ee18ef66f3264337528.png

5.SELECT语句的详细用法;

SELECT语句可以用来查询数据库里面的数据,知道它的各种用法可以很快的完成查询操作:

1.基本用法

a1a070c7c326ec638e50d4418029f21b.png

比如

9f8cfbe15b676d8ffcba2142e28cbfda.png

而要查询数据库中某个表的所有列就是 SELECT * FROM + 表名 ;

* 就代表要查询所有的列

2.

daec1b45a2d2940f5a992cf4235080aa.png

3c76b3c5a5bdb1fee65e27b49597feb8.png

以上语句 加了个where age > 25 ;

就查找出了所有age大于25 的啦。

582e9753eb6cc7d06b46e638573e13ec.png

3.AND 和OR:

5c4e387ac7729603160daf49223ea387.png

4.IN 和 NOT IN:

0a3449f6b1a514f39f060e98e5391ee6.png

5.通配符:

fc86c294619b77b3a1c63ce53c055520.png

37704f9a9da5dcd340731be531f9030f.png

6,对结果进行排序:

为了使查询结果看起来更顺眼,我们可能需要对结果按某一列来排序,这就要用到 ORDER BY 排序关键词。默认情况下,ORDER BY 的结果是升序排列,而使用关键词 ASC 和 DESC 可指定升序或降序排序。 比如,我们按 salary 降序排列,SQL语句为:

944f81ff90c629302a77e600bfbdad71.png

以上就是我学习的一些语法笔记了,个人感觉SQL语句特别好理解,初学起来个平时语言很相像,总之努力学习吧!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值